About

Description

Cozy one bedroom in prime location for sale by owner.
Brownstone walk up on a quiet tree lined street.
Charming exposed brink wall and original fireplace, fully renovated kitchen and bath and 13 feet of California closets.
Custom sized furniture (as seen in photos) is negotiable.
One block to Central Park, two blocks to 2,3,9,B,C subways.
Co-op approval required.

Named after and defined by the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ts, Lincoln Square is home to the New York Philharmonic, the New York City Ballet and the Metropolitan Opera, among many other cultural institutions. The neighborhood blends the prewar architecture and and style of the Upper West Side with modern, tall residential buildings. Great subway access at Columbus Circle and proximity to Midtown make this neighborhood popular with those looking to be in the center of it all.
